Description
In this engaging exploration of technology, Don Brown delves into the revolutionary concepts surrounding computers and their impact on society. He highlights the innovations and thinkers that have shaped the digital world, unraveling complex ideas in an accessible way. With a focus on the evolution of machines capable of thought, readers are invited to consider the implications of artificial intelligence and automation.
Brown's expertly crafted narrative not only informs but inspires curiosity about the future of technology. Through vivid examples and a clear presentation of pivotal milestones in computing history, he adeptly captures the essence of how these machines transform everyday life.
